Transaction 753389ecea1c937872dfe871b85be1f95afc07cfbf10a082f42e158626eeaaab

1 Input
2 Outputs
  • 753389ecea1c937872dfe871b85be1f95afc07cfbf10a082f42e158626eeaaab:0
  • value  23177000
    address  3J51CWYnXHtdiVMmPivSc1Nnhpm88GiNCP
  • 753389ecea1c937872dfe871b85be1f95afc07cfbf10a082f42e158626eeaaab:1
  • value  700089536
    address  35qCJi5ddWorgpgQ88EAHn8HgLtFtZYVTD